How It Works

The spreadsheet is designed to be user-friendly, even if you’re not a tech-savvy person. To get started, just click the link and add a copy to your own Google Drive. From there, you can either use it online or download it to your computer or smartphone. Once it’s saved, you can start entering your information straight away.


Features

  • Weight Tracking: Option to keep tabs daily or weekly, and look for patterns.
  • Exercise Tracker: Record your workouts and step count and monitor your activity levels.
  • Progress Charts: Visualise your weight loss journey with graphs that show your progress.
  • Motivational Notes: Write down your thoughts, achievements, and goals to stay motivated and focused.
  • Daily Habit Tracker: Tick off your great habits and compare the frequency to your goals.
  • Water Tracker: A great way to encourage a higher consumption of water.
